Latest Patents
One of her latest patents is titled "Cloud-native global file system with rapid ransomware recovery." This innovation introduces a cloud-native global file system that includes a rapid ransomware recovery service. Upon detecting a ransomware attack, access to the affected volume is restricted, and a recovery filer is activated to initiate a restore operation. This process ensures that a new clean snapshot of the volume is created, allowing for the re-enabling of access once the recovery is complete.
Another notable patent is "Cloud-native global file system with multi-site support using push classes." This technique facilitates data sharing among multiple filers in a cloud object store. It allows a local filer to determine if other filers have a consistent view of new data being written. The process involves associating files into a 'push class' and managing the push operation according to specific criteria, ensuring efficient data synchronization across the cloud.
